Understanding the Role of Roof Flashings

Roof flashings are the first line of defense against the intrusion of water, playing a crucial role in safeguarding the structural integrity of your home. These specialized components are designed to redirect water away from critical areas, preventing it from seeping through and causing water damage, mold, or even structural compromises.

The primary function of roof flashings is to create a seamless transition between the roofing material and the various roof penetrations, such as chimneys, vents, skylights, and dormers. By overlapping and interlocking with these elements, flashings create a barrier that prevents water from infiltrating the vulnerable gaps and seams.

Proper installation and regular maintenance of roof flashings are essential in ensuring their long-term effectiveness. Flashings that are improperly installed or neglected over time can become compromised, leading to leaks and subsequent water damage that can be both costly and disruptive to address.

Identifying Common Flashing Issues

As a roofing professional, I’ve encountered a wide range of flashing-related problems, each with the potential to undermine the storm-resistant performance of your roof. By familiarizing yourself with these common issues, you can proactively inspect your roof and address any concerns before they escalate into larger, more complex problems.

Loose or Damaged Flashings
One of the most prevalent flashing issues is the loosening or detachment of these critical components. High winds, heavy rainfall, and even the natural expansion and contraction of building materials can cause flashings to become dislodged or damaged over time. This compromises the watertight seal, leaving your roof vulnerable to leaks and water intrusion.

Corrosion and Rust
Depending on the type of flashing material used, corrosion and rust can become a significant concern, particularly in coastal or humid environments. Metal flashings, such as those made from aluminum or galvanized steel, are susceptible to oxidation and degradation, weakening their structural integrity and waterproofing capabilities.

Improper Sealing
Flashings are only effective when they are properly sealed to the surrounding roofing material and roof penetrations. Inadequate sealing, whether due to poor installation or the deterioration of sealants over time, can create gaps and allow water to seep through, undermining the flashing’s primary function.

Cracking and Splitting
Plastic or rubber flashings, while often more affordable than their metal counterparts, can become brittle and crack over time, especially when exposed to extreme temperatures, UV radiation, or the stress of building movement. These cracks and splits compromise the flashing’s ability to create a watertight barrier.

Debris Buildup
Over time, leaves, twigs, and other debris can accumulate around flashings, obstructing water drainage and leading to the formation of standing water. This standing water can accelerate the deterioration of the flashing material and contribute to the development of leaks.

By regularly inspecting your roof flashings and addressing any of these common issues promptly, you can ensure that your roofing system remains resilient and prepared to withstand the challenges posed by storms and extreme weather conditions.

Proactive Maintenance Strategies

Maintaining the integrity of your roof flashings is an ongoing process that requires vigilance and a proactive approach. As an experienced roofing professional, I recommend the following strategies to keep your flashings in top condition and ensure optimal storm-resistant performance:

Routine Inspections
Scheduling regular roof inspections, at least twice a year, is essential for identifying and addressing any flashing-related issues before they escalate. During these inspections, carefully examine all flashings for signs of wear, damage, or improper sealing, and make note of any areas that require attention.

Cleaning and Debris Removal
Regularly clearing away leaves, twigs, and other debris from around your flashings is crucial in maintaining their effectiveness. Buildup of debris can obstruct water drainage and lead to the formation of standing water, which can accelerate the deterioration of the flashing material.

Sealant Reapplication
Over time, the sealants used to secure flashings to the surrounding roofing material can degrade, compromising the watertight seal. Proactively reapplying high-quality sealants, such as silicone or polyurethane-based products, can help maintain the integrity of your flashing installations.

Flashing Replacement
Despite your best efforts, there may come a time when the flashings on your roof need to be replaced entirely. This is particularly true for older roofs or in cases where the flashings have suffered significant damage or corrosion. Replacing worn or compromised flashings is an essential step in ensuring the continued protection of your home.

Professional Inspections and Maintenance
While homeowners can perform basic flashing maintenance tasks, it’s advisable to enlist the help of a professional roofing contractor for more complex inspections and repairs. Experienced roofers can identify and address any underlying issues, as well as provide recommendations for optimizing the storm-resistant performance of your roof’s flashings.

By implementing these proactive maintenance strategies, you can extend the lifespan of your roof flashings and ensure that your home remains well-protected against the onslaught of storms and extreme weather events.

Selecting Storm-Resistant Flashing Materials

The choice of flashing material can have a significant impact on the storm-resistant capabilities of your roofing system. As a seasoned roofing professional, I recommend considering the following materials when selecting flashings for your Northampton home:

Aluminum Flashings
Aluminum is a popular choice for roof flashings due to its superior corrosion resistance and durability. Aluminum flashings are lightweight, easy to install, and can withstand the effects of heavy rain, high winds, and flying debris. Additionally, aluminum’s natural reflective properties can help improve the energy efficiency of your home by reducing heat transfer.

Stainless Steel Flashings
For an even more robust and long-lasting solution, stainless steel flashings are an excellent choice. Stainless steel is highly resistant to corrosion, ensuring that your flashings will maintain their integrity and performance even in harsh coastal or industrial environments. While slightly more expensive than aluminum, stainless steel flashings offer unparalleled durability and storm-resistant capabilities.

Copper Flashings
Copper flashings are a premium option that not only provide exceptional protection but also add a unique aesthetic appeal to your roofing system. Copper is highly resistant to corrosion and can withstand the rigors of extreme weather conditions, including high winds, heavy rainfall, and even hail impact. However, copper flashings do come with a higher price tag compared to other flashing materials.

Rubber or Plastic Flashings
For areas with less exposure to the elements, such as around vents or small roof penetrations, rubber or plastic flashings can be a cost-effective solution. While not as durable as their metal counterparts, these materials can still provide adequate protection against water intrusion, provided they are properly installed and maintained.

Regardless of the flashing material you choose, it’s crucial to ensure that the installation is executed with precision and care, following the manufacturer’s guidelines and local building codes. Proper installation is key to maximizing the storm-resistant performance of your roof’s flashings.

Integrating Flashings into a Comprehensive Storm-Proof Roofing System

While roof flashings play a vital role in safeguarding your home against the elements, they are just one component of a comprehensive storm-proof roofing system. To ensure your Northampton property is well-equipped to withstand the challenges posed by storms and extreme weather, it’s essential to consider the following additional roofing features and strategies:

Impact-Resistant Roofing Materials
Selecting roofing materials that are designed to withstand the impact of wind-borne debris and hail is crucial in a storm-prone region like Northampton. Metal, tile, and impact-resistant asphalt shingles are all excellent options that can help safeguard your home against the destructive forces of severe weather.

Secure Roof Attachment
Ensuring that your roofing system is firmly attached to the underlying structure is paramount in maintaining its integrity during high winds. Techniques such as the use of hurricane straps or reinforced fasteners can help anchor your roof and prevent it from being lifted or torn off by powerful gusts.

Roof Ventilation and Insulation
Proper roof ventilation and insulation not only enhance the energy efficiency of your home but also play a vital role in preventing water intrusion and damage. Well-designed ventilation systems can help regulate attic temperatures and reduce the risk of condensation, while effective insulation can minimize the potential for ice dams and other weather-related issues.

Drainage System Maintenance
Ensuring that your roof’s drainage system, including gutters and downspouts, is clear of debris and functioning correctly is essential in directing water away from your home’s foundation and preventing water pooling that can compromise the structural integrity of your roof.

By integrating a comprehensive approach that includes high-quality flashings, impact-resistant roofing materials, secure roof attachment, proper ventilation and insulation, and a well-maintained drainage system, you can create a resilient roofing system that is prepared to withstand the challenges posed by storms and extreme weather events in Northampton.
